Factors Affecting Cost
- Severity of Crack: Minor cracks are generally less expensive to fix than major structural issues.
- Foundation Type: Different foundation materials (concrete, brick, etc.) can affect repair cost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require more labor and specialized equipment.
- Repair Method: Various techniques like epoxy injection, polyurethane foam, or carbon fiber reinforcement have different cost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in North Little Rock can influence overall expenses.
- Permits and Inspections: Some repairs may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task Description | Average Cost (North Little Rock, AR) |
|---|---|
| Minor Crack Repair | $300 - $600 |
| Epoxy Injection | $350 - $900 |
| Polyurethane Foam Injection | $400 - $1,000 |
| Carbon Fiber Reinforcement | $600 - $1,200 |
| Major Structural Repair | $1,500 - $4,000 |
| Foundation Inspection | $200 - $500 |
|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
